I was served papers on a so called bad debit back in Feb. 08. Stating that I owe $18,000 plus to Beneficial. Were this Debit come from is unclear to me. I called Messerli & Kramer to talk to them about this I was better off talking to a wall. I tried to tell them that their must be some sort of mistake and should recheck this. The person on the other end told me that I had to put it in writing. Fine ! I mailed them stating the same I even went as far as telling them that I would send them $50.00 per paycheck until this got resolved, and that I was going thru a divorce tat the same time so that was all I would be able to send at the time. By the time I was going to make the 3rd they had gone to court and got a Judgment. I was not even told that this was happening. If I'm being sued aren't I suppose to be notified of the court date so that I can defend my self?

Now they garnished my pay 25% per pay check ! And the 18,000 plus turned into $26,377.21. That hurts when you're a single parent with two minor children trying to rebuild one life again. I tried to arrange payments - I've made payments and they excepted them, they did not say no to them! I really need Help. I have two young children, Don't get any child support, Can't work a 2nd job. Some one help Please.
